Average Public Safety Telecommunicators Salary in Upper Peninsula of Michigan nonmetropolitan area

The average salary for a Public Safety Telecommunicators in Upper Peninsula of Michigan nonmetropolitan area is $48,780. This compensation is in line with national standards, reflecting a balanced and stable local job market.

Executive Summary

  • Average Salary: $48,780 per year.
  •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 13.0% over the last 5 years.
  •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$58,050.
  • Outlook: The current demand for Public Safety Telecommunicatorss is stable, with a local workforce of approximately 70 professionals. This role remains a specialized component of the broader Upper Peninsula of Michigan nonmetropolitan area economy.

How much does a Public Safety Telecommunicators make in Upper Peninsula of Michigan nonmetropolitan area?

The median annual salary for a Public Safety Telecommunicators in Upper Peninsula of Michigan nonmetropolitan area is $48,780. This typically ranges from $41,600 for entry-level positions to $58,050 for top-level roles.

How does the salary compare to the national average?

The average salary for this role in Upper Peninsula of Michigan nonmetropolitan area is 0.8% lower than the national median of $49,180.
